WedbushCares is our corporate giving initiative dedicated to supporting, educating, and sustaining the communities we serve. Through charitable partnerships, volunteer initiatives, donation matching, and colleague-driven campaigns, showing up for our communities is part of our firm’s legacy.
Susan G. Komen aims to save lives by meeting the most critical needs in our communities and investing in breakthrough research to prevent and cure breast cancer.
Volunteerism examples: Participate in SGK walks. Help fundraise.
Scholastic Book Fairs are magical and unforgettable experiences that provide elementary children from low-income families access to free quality books, which increases literacy rates and encourages a love for reading.
Volunteerism examples: Be a greeter, a classroom book reader, or help students select books during a Wedbush/Scholastic book fair.
Rapunzl is investing in the next generation of investors by educating and inspiring students from Historically Black Colleges and Universities (i.e., HBCUs) about the importance of taking charge of their personal finances and pursuing financial services careers.
Volunteerism examples: Facilitate a financial literacy workshop. Serve as a panelist for a career panel. Be a firm representative at a campus event.

Financial Literacy
Access to financial knowledge creates opportunity. Through WISE, we partner with schools and nonprofits to bring hands-on financial education to students of all ages.
Our partnership with Rapunzl lets students manage simulated $10,000 portfolios and learn by doing – making investing tangible and accessible.
We also support broader literacy initiatives, from book fairs to reading programs, because we know that building confident, knowledgeable young people starts well before they enter the workforce.
